In Reply To Is there a write up for this? If not can you give a quick posted by ChrisZTT (Sacto, CA) on May 09, 2007 at 11:49 PM
     
Message It's realy simple. You just install the recirculation fitting on the BOV, then run a hose from the BOV to the stock location that the recircs originally blow air into. It's a tight fit to be honest, so the hose I had to use to make the tight 180 degree bend back up to the air tube was bought from oreilys and is a thick black rubber hose with a metal coil inside to keep it from kinking at all with tight bends. It would be nice if the opening of the BOV would face the air intake tube, but instead the only way it fits is away from it, but it's no biggy once you get the right hose.
